NEW YORK, Feb. 11,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— Report on how AI is driving market transformation – The global augmented reality and virtual reality market size is estimated to grow by USD 442.99 billion from 2024-2028, according to Technavio. The market is estimated to grow at a CAGR of 50.22% during the forecast period. Growing demand for AR and VR technology is driving market growth, with a trend towards growing funding in startup ar and vr companies from investors. However, high development costs associated with AR and VR apps poses a challenge. Industries from consumer electronics to aerospace & defense are embracing these technologies to enhance user experience, improve efficiency, and drive productivity.In the realm of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R) market, creating engaging projects involves various intricate components. Cost considerations are crucial, encompassing expenses for VR content creation and distribution, as well as hardware and software costs. For instance, 360-degree cameras are utilized to generate panoramic content at a relatively lower cost compared to computer-generated graphics. However, the real value of VR games lies in their interactive content. To create lifelike VR content, a combination of 360-degree cameras, computer graphics, and high-end photorealistic cameras is necessary. The approximate cost for developing only the VR content for an app falls between USD50,000 and USD100,000.

NEW YORK, May 5, 2026 /PRNewswire/ — Vernal Capital Acquisition Corp. (NYSE: VECA) (“Vernal”) announced the pricing of its initial public offering (the “IPO”) of 10,000,000 units at $10.00 per unit. The units are expected to trade on the New York Stock Exchange (“NYSE”) under “VECAU” beginning May 6, 2026. Each unit consists of one ordinary share and one right to receive one-fourth of one ordinary share upon consummation of an initial business combination. Upon separate trading, the ordinary shares and rights are expected to be listed on NYSE under “VECA” and “VECAR,” respectively.

D. Boral Capital LLC is acting as sole book-running manager of the offering. The underwriters have a 45-day option to purchase up to 1,500,000 additional units to cover any over-allotments. The offering is expected to close on May 7, 2026, subject to customary closing conditions.

CHARLOTTESVILLE, Va., May 5, 2026 /PRNewswire/ — RIVANNA®, developer of AI-powered clinical decision-support solutions, today announced that it has been nominated for MedTech Scale-Up of the Year at the MedTech World Awards 2026 | North America. Public voting is open through Friday, May 8, 2026, with category winners to be announced at the inaugural North American Awards Gala on May 11, 2026, at the Hilton West Palm Beach in Florida.

The MedTech Scale-Up of the Year category honors a growth-stage company successfully scaling revenues, partnerships, and adoption across the global medical technology ecosystem. Nominees across the program’s 22 categories were selected through a structured process led by the MedTech World Steering Committee, with category winners determined by a combination of expert evaluation and public voting from the global MedTech community.

The award nomination follows a year of measurable scaling for RIVANNA:

In October 2025, RIVANNA reported on being named a finalist in MedTech Innovator’s 2025 Early-Stage Grand Prize competition, selected from nearly 1,500 global applicants to represent the top 4% of medtech innovations worldwide.In December 2025, RIVANNA reported on the U.S. Food and Drug Administration’s 510(k) clearance of its Accuro® 3S Needle Guide Kit consumables, building on existing Accuro 3S device clearance.In April 2026, RIVANNA reported on peer-reviewed findings, published in 2025 in the Journal of Emergency Medicine (DOI: 10.1016/j.jemermed.2025.11.011), showing that the Accuro® XV musculoskeletal imaging system enables non-physician operators to acquire diagnostic-quality scans after just one hour of hands-on training.In May 2026, RIVANNA reported on the U.S. Food and Drug Administration’s 510(k) clearance of the Accuro® XV Diagnostic Ultrasound System for musculoskeletal imaging, authorizing commercial use across hospital and clinic settings.The company’s clinical program now spans eight sites nationwide with more than 1,500 patients enrolled.

TORONTO, May 5, 2026 /PRNewswire/ – D2L, a global leader in learning innovation, hosted its first-ever D2L Launch Week, a four-day virtual webinar series spotlighting the company’s latest product innovations across D2L Brightspace in 2026.

Throughout the week, D2L showcased a range of product releases through live demos and practical customer use cases, highlighting how institutions, school districts and organizations can help to drive engagement and improve learning outcomes. The featured updates include enhancements to D2L Lumi for idea generation, intervention suggestions, quiz creation and summarization; tools to strengthen parent and guardian outreach; and administrative capabilities designed to help large organizations delegate course and configuration management more effectively.

“We’re proud to showcase the ways D2L continues to innovate to help make learning more personalized, efficient, and scalable,” said Christian Pantel, Chief Product Officer at D2L. “From new D2L Lumi features to enhanced communication tools and more flexible distributed administration capabilities, these updates are designed to help our customers save time, improve usability, and deliver better learning experiences at scale.”

Enhancements to D2L Lumi

Among the new capabilities were several updates to D2L’s AI-native tool, D2L Lumi, designed to improve usability, transparency, and alignment across workflows, including:

D2L Lumi Ideas: Generates assignment and discussion ideas directly within Brightspace, making it easier to generate high quality content aligned to learning outcomes.D2L Lumi Insights: Gives educators access to learning intervention suggestions, designed to provide recommended next steps based on learner data.D2L Lumi Quiz: Helps educators generate questions from multiple course content topics and includes a more streamlined question-generation workflow.D2L Lumi Summary: Supports summarization from more content sources, including nested submodules, and can give educators the ability to preview and adjust source text before summarization.

Updates to Parent and Guardian Communications

D2L also introduced new parent and guardian communication enhancements to help K-12 educators strengthen engagement beyond the classroom. Teachers can now send bulk emails to all parents and guardians associated with students in their class. For individual student outreach, teachers can also email parents and guardians of a specific learner, making it easier to share timely updates on student progress and classroom activity.

Manage Distributed Administration at Scale

Distributed Administration gives organizations more flexibility to delegate administrative responsibilities across organization levels. With Distributed Administration, administrators can manage specific areas, enabling them to oversee courses while helping to reduce bottlenecks and free up time.
